The Angel is a large lovely village country pub situated on the A4 roadside between Reading and Newbury.

A large carpark to the right of the building and a new overflow carpark at the back of the garden provides space for approx. 50 cars so there is plenty of room to fit you in.

We have a pretty front patio with glass screens to protect you from the noise of the road and wind but still allowing you to sit under an umbrella and watch the world go by. Out the back, we have a covered courtyard with plenty of seating and heating and a grassy area with benches and a large grassed area for children. All of our outdoor areas get bathed in sunshine so it’s a lovely way to pass the day with a cool drink and maybe something to eat.

We have a bar area with dining seating and a comfortable restaurant area to choose from our extensive daily carvery and a la carte menus. We also have an alcove area with high bench seating and tables and a big screen television showing live sport. Sunday carvery is served in our function room towards the back that leads on to the garden and fills the restaurant with delicious aromas.

Our function room seats approximately 40 people, which we can hire out for your special event such as birthdays, weddings, conferences, meetings or simply a get together.
